Sync Question

I dont use it much (2013 Boss Mustang) so I cant say if it has been working lately but yesterday I paired a new phone to it. No issues and I can dial out and receive calls manually. However, when I try to use any vioce commands the system does not recognize them at all - like the mic is just dead. Any suggestions? Did I possibly need to do somenhtinhg else when setting up the new phone?

Well, in case anyone has the same issue, I pulled the #3 fuse from the passanger side kick panel fuse box. Left it out for 20 minutes and reinstalled.

The system works again.

I know that in our 2012 Explorer there is a setting in the sync menu for Novice or Pro. Switching it to Pro means that when you press the voice button you just get the beep. There are no prompts at all from the system. Perhaps the Mustang has a similar setting. There are prompts at other times, which can be interrupted by pushing the sync button as youngstang90 mentioned.
